Hon. Alfred Ajang has officially submitted his Nomination and Expression of Interest Forms to the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Abuja, signaling a significant step in his aspiration to represent the people of Jos South/Jos East Federal Constituency.

The development reflects his continued commitment to purposeful leadership, quality representation, and people-oriented governance. Speaking after the submission, Hon. Ajang reaffirmed his dedication to the ideals of unity, progress, and inclusive development, emphasizing the need for stronger representation that truly reflects the aspirations of the people.

He described the moment as not just a personal milestone, but a collective movement driven by the desire to build a better future for the constituency through effective leadership and active engagement with the people.
